Transaction 73cedb76cef9d1ac215fe36db589af5168d5d80c7a4bb865f5359dfc5c7c33d9

1 Input
1 Outputs
  • 73cedb76cef9d1ac215fe36db589af5168d5d80c7a4bb865f5359dfc5c7c33d9:0
  • value  1321484834
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Y